They were dancing or danced on the dance floor grammer .which one do we choose dancing or dance grammatically

English
2 answers:
vovikov84 [41]4 years ago
8 0

Answer: dancing

Explanation: because they are doing it right now, not in the past

choli [55]4 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Dancing

Explanation:

Basically, if you use danced, the sentence would have to be They DANCED. So, they already danced. But, since the sentence is "they were", it would be "they were dancing".
